Harmor Ari, the Secondary Realm that’s connected to Jupiter, is also known as “The Light Realm”. That Light Realm name comes from the fact that the Harmens, the inhabitants of Harmor Ari, are fist sized balls of blue light.
Unable to be understood by most of the other Secondary Beings (non humans) for a long time, they collaborated with the Netral to create organic bodies that resembled humans. But the closest that they could get to looking like humans was to have pale blue skin that gave them a deathly beauty that was enhanced by light blue veins that gave their harvested bodies a translucent look. The Harmens could enter and exit these bodies at any time, but they only used them when travelling to other realms.
Their blue skinned humanoid bodies are placed in cemetery like areas which came off as a sort of tribute to humanity, while their “spirit” forms wandered around living in cities. The other Secondary Realms nicknamed them “Celestials” and “Visions” for their ethereal luminescence.
Their realm resembles the highlands of Scotland with lush forests and great, serene lakes. Their town architecture resembles a quasi futuristic India while their castles are old style Scottish mixed with feudal Japan.
The Harmens major source of income and main export is energy production. This realm is also known for producing great instruments, the most popular instrument being the flute like “tote”.
Negasis is the Secondary Realm that is located through the Portanexus gate of Neptune.
Negasis is the most technologically advanced of all the realms. Only the Secondary Realm of Fegra comes close but where the Netrel (the citizens of Negasis) technological advancements are applied to societal living, the Fegarians are advanced in weapon and military vehicle design.
The Netrel, in the beginning, lived on the only inhabitable planet in the realm of Negasis. At some point, their ecosphere became flawed and would not allow sustainable life to exist there. So, with their great minds, they decided to create a controlled artificial world to live on. To build this world, they had to start in space.
The Netrel designed artificial bodies to inhabit so they could build the artificial world Netra-Six (named after the sixth design that was decided on by the Netrel to use). They were able to create bodies that not only would be able to survive space’s cold oxygen less recesses, but would also adapt to the new ecosphere they created. The artificial bodies would still be able to procreate and do anything that their original bodies were supposed to.
The Netrel resembled humans the most out of all the Secondary Beings, but when they transferred their spirits over to their new bodies, their skin had a very plastic look to it and all the hair that grew from their bodies were all white. This look earned the Netral the nickname offrealmers would give to them, Artificials.
From the birth of Netra-Six, their minds were so intelligent, other realms (except for Fegra, who were kind of close to figuring out Netrel tech) could not comprehend the technology of the Artificials. Therefore, once the Treshians’ VML (Vainglory Model Law) was installed into the interrealm structure, the Netral biggest export was advanced technology and, through this product,they became the biggest export realm in the trading system. The Netrel economy became solely reliant on exporting.
The Netrel culture are not adept at any type of military structure because they find war trite and meaningless. This is not to say they are pacifists, but they try to avoid war at any cost.
Karussh is the Secondary Realm that is located through the Portanexus gate of Uranus.
In this Secondary Realm of Karussh there is no light on the inhabited planet and it is home to various sentient and non-sentient creatures. There is a very wind and rainy feel to this forested planet without light.
One of the many creatures that inhabit this darkened world are the quasi-sentient Slaver (aka Shadowdwellers). The Slaver come in two types: the Newe, the dominant “logical clan”; and the Grinners, the anarchic, gruesome underlings to the Newe.
This realm is also home to the Grall, a race of creature that have a trickster like nature.
The Grall and the Slavers are two of many such creatures that live in “The Dark Realm”.
